Output e5756efe7242c98ce2d7d9bd650cb47c90dffec7ef9f039d1535497129aea2bc:1

value
80579767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fced8d3a0ea4535c381f2c122b585c072d80682 OP_EQUAL
address
38y16gJVLdxU5L1iUbmJwVUgFVKJWq8kDY
transaction
e5756efe7242c98ce2d7d9bd650cb47c90dffec7ef9f039d1535497129aea2bc
confirmations
319534
spent
true